Overall Mission
The overall mission/purpose of the measurement subcommittee is to work cooperatively to support the SBO/SBEAP National Steering Committee, improve SBEAP measurement information, training, and resources, and respond to SBEAP measurement needs in a timely manner. 

History
The measurement subcommittee was initiated as a result of the Working Session at the 2004 SBO/SBAP National Conference in Sacramento, California.  At the 2005 National Conference in Biloxi, Mississippi, there was a renewed interest in the measurement subcommittee considering the current issues with multimedia assistance and the efforts of the promotional subcommittee.  The subcommittee has completed the development of a Nationwide Logic Model and common measures from the Logic Model with the assistance of the EPA National Center for Environmental Innovation's Evaluation Support Division (NCEI ESD).  The models were presented at the 2006 SBO/SBEAP National Conference in Bretton Woods, New Hampshire.  In 2006, the subcommittee conducted a nationwide survey of measures designed to gauge interest in measurement as a whole and provide a mechanism for prioritizing the host of measures identified by the logic models.  From the survey results, the subcommittee developed a set of core measures and worked with EPA's Office of Small Business Ombudsman to propose changes to the Information Collection Request (ICF) in 2007.  In May 2008, the subcommittee received word that the changes were not accepted.  EPA is working on a response to OMB's comments.

Future Plans
Future plans include:  1) identifying outcome measures for data gathering in 2010, as a supplement to the Annual Reporting Form, 2) developing a tracking tool to assist with annual reporting, and 3) working cooperatively with other subcommittees to incorporate measurement issues.
